A Century and Four Score: Giselle, Julia Garner, Sissy Spacek and Others Star In Loewe’s Anniversary Campaign

The brand ambassadors evoke humor and wit as they hold iconic bags throughout the brand’s history…

 

Shot by photographer Talia Chetrit, the campaign honors the Spanish brand’s history that was birthed in 1846 by artists in a small workshop in Madrid. Leather has always been Loewe’s specialty. To tell this century and four score campaign story, the cast of women appear with Loewe bags throughout the decades. The Flamenco clutch (launched in the 1980s, the Puzzle (launched in 2015), the new Amazona 180 (a design first launched in 1975), all “embody the brand’s singular approach to construction, materiality, and movement” according to announcement notes.

Alongside the campaign is a capsule collection that will land in stores and on loewe.com on June 3rd. Featuring ready-to-wear- leather goods, and bags, the collection is a nod to the heritage of the brand with lion motifs- a recalling of the meaning of Loewe in German which is lion. Standing alongside the capsule collection is an animated film, narrated by actor Antonio Banderas. The film details the brand’s, well, details, highlighting the fact that in 1872, German merchant Enrique Loewe Roessberg unified Loewe (then a collective of artisans); and it shows how the brand was appointed supplier to the Spanish crown in 1905, and established the Loewe Foundation in 1988. And, standing alongside the animated film will be a special publication, 180 Years of Craft that will be part of Issue 11 of the Loewe Magazine.
